Transaction 67780f45a63f931d8c37c8429b2fcf771933fbde229f0709198bf2881535fda4
1 Input
1 Output
-
67780f45a63f931d8c37c8429b2fcf771933fbde229f0709198bf2881535fda4:0
- value
- 43090293
- script pubkey
- OP_0 OP_PUSHBYTES_20 db343fdfe9bcad9b6538644b09e976db216b3f53
- address
- bc1qmv6rlhlfhjkekefcv39sn6tkmvskk06nqcx4es